In a medium saucepan add the vinegar, water, salt, and sugar, mix, and bring to a boil. Once salt has dissolved, remove from heat while you assemble your jars.
Fill wide-mouth mason jars with the green beans.
Add any desired spices and mix-ins.
Pour the hot liquid over the veggies until each jar is full. Close the jars and store in the fridge.

Choose the Right Jar: For the crispiest pickled green beans, use wide-mouth mason jars that allow air to escape easily when you pack the beans tightly. This also makes it easier to remove the beans when you're ready to enjoy them, ensuring they maintain their perfect crunch.
Customize Your Crunch: If you prefer your pickled green beans on the firmer side, reduce the brine's boiling time before pouring it over the beans. A shorter boil means a crisper bite, letting you tailor the texture to your taste.
Flavor Infusion: Give your pickled green beans a unique twist by experimenting with different spices and herbs in the brine. Adding a slice of lemon, a sprig of rosemary, or a few slices of fresh ginger can infuse your pickles with subtle, distinctive flavors that make each jar uniquely delicious.
